Characteristics of 7 patients with PE-TLIF.
| Case number | Sex | Age (years) | Pathological cause | Lesion segment | Intermittent claudication (meters) | Duration of symptom (years) | Comorbidity |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Female | 77 | Severe LSS | L4/5 | 100 | 4 | Pulmonary Fibrosis, Hypertension, Hyperlipidemia |
| 2 | Male | 43 | Moderate LSS | L4/5 | None | 3 | None |
| 3 | Female | 57 | Moderate LSS | L4/5 | 100 | 2 | None |
| 4 | Female | 48 | Mild LSS | L4/5 | 50 | 1 | None |
| 5 | Female | 43 | Moderate LSS | L4/5 | 100 | 3 | Hypertension, Diabetes |
| 6 | Female | 68 | LSS with degenerative spondylolisthesis | L4/5 | 100 | 20 | None |
| 7 | Female | 63 | Moderate LSS | L4/5 | None | 2 | None |

Figure 5A 57-year-old female patient who had low back pain with right leg pain and numbness for 2 years, intermittent claudication 100m, and was treated by PE-TLIF. (a) Preoperative MRI and CT images showed a moderate lumbar spinal stenosis. (b) Preoperative X-ray image showed no instability. (c) Postoperative X-ray image showed a good implantation position. (d) Six-month follow-up X-ray image showed neither disc space subsidence nor implantation breakage. (e) Postoperative CT scan image. (f) Six-month follow-up CT scan image showed a standard lumbar fusion.
